What are Chinese Stocks Trading in the US?

Chinese stocks trading in the US refer to shares of Chinese companies that are listed and traded on US stock exchanges. These companies are often referred to as "Chinese ADRs" (American Depositary Receipts) or "Chinese ETFs" (Exchange Traded Funds). Some of the most well-known Chinese stocks trading in the US include Alibaba, Baidu, and Tencent.

Advantages of Investing in Chinese Stocks Trading in the US

  1. Access to a Growing Market: China is the world's second-largest economy, and its stock market has been growing rapidly. Investing in Chinese stocks can provide investors with access to this fast-growing market.
  2. Diversification: Investing in Chinese stocks can help diversify an investment portfolio, reducing the risk of market fluctuations.
  3. High Growth Potential: Many Chinese companies are at the forefront of technological innovation and have high growth potential.

Risks of Investing in Chinese Stocks Trading in the US

  1. Political and Regulatory Risks: The Chinese government has a significant influence on the country's stock market, and political and regulatory changes can impact the performance of Chinese stocks.
  2. Currency Risk: The Chinese yuan is not freely convertible, and fluctuations in the exchange rate can impact the returns on Chinese stocks.
  3. Information Risk: Information about Chinese companies can be difficult to obtain, and this can make it challenging for investors to make informed decisions.

Strategies for Investing in Chinese Stocks Trading in the US

  1. Research and Due Diligence: It is crucial to conduct thorough research and due diligence before investing in Chinese stocks. This includes analyzing the company's financial statements, business model, and management team.
  2. Diversify Your Portfolio: Diversifying your portfolio can help mitigate the risks associated with investing in Chinese stocks.
  3. Consider Using ETFs: Exchange Traded Funds (ETFs) that track the performance of the Chinese stock market can be a convenient way to invest in Chinese stocks without having to buy individual shares.
